If you've followed the game since it was first announced, it actually started out as an MMO tied to Black Desert (back in 2023, if I remember right). But somewhere during development, the devs decided to shift gears and make it a single-player game instead.

I honestly don't see it becoming a full MMO anymore. Multiplayer? Sure, that's possible. In fact, I think that's way more likely. If I remember correctly, the Pearl Abyss CEO even mentioned multiplayer in a press conference, but they were still dealing with technical limitations, and it sounded like something that's still years away.
